INTERIOR LIGHT CONTROL SWITCH

The interior light control switch has three positions: ON, DOOR and OFF.

ON position

When the switch is in the ON position 1 the map lights and rear personal lights will illuminate.

DOOR position

When the switch is in the DOOR position 2 , the map lights and rear personal lights will illuminate under the following conditions:

► ignition switch is switched to the LOCK or OFF position — remain on for about 15 seconds.
► doors are unlocked by pushing the UNLOCK button on the Intelligent Key or door handle request switch with the ignition switch in the LOCK or OFF position — remain on for about 15 seconds.
► any door is opened and then closed with the ignition switch in the LOCK or OFF position — remain on for about 15 seconds.
► any door is opened with the ignition switch in the ACC or ON position — remain on while the door is opened. When the door is closed, the lights go off. The lights will also turn off after 15 minutes when the lights remain illuminated after the ignition switch has been pushed to the OFF or LOCK position to prevent the battery from becoming discharged. When the auto interior illumination is set to the OFF position (see “Vehicle information and settings” in the “4. Monitor, climate, audio, phone and voice recognition systems” section), the lights will illuminate under the following condition:
► any door is opened with the ignition switch in any position — remain on while the door is opened. When the door is closed, the lights go off.

OFF position

When the switch is in the OFF position3 , the lights will not illuminate, regardless of the condition.

CAUTION
Do not use for extended periods of time with the engine stopped. This could result in a discharged battery.
